Description

An Owners Manual for your studio! The electric kiln has helped to open the doors of the ceramic world to more and more people due to its convenience, ease of use, and economical benefits, and this new edition of Electric Kiln Ceramics is a must-read for anyone firing electric kilns. With the wealth of information on making work, decorating work, glazing work, and firing work, this book is not just a manual for the kiln itself, but for the whole studio as well. This fourth edition of Electric Kiln Ceramics, Richard Zakin s seminal work on understanding and using the electric kiln to its fullest potential, has been completely rewritten, reorganized, and expanded by Frederick Bartolovic. Hand picked by Zakin to carry the title forward, Bartolovic has added new sections with step-by-step instruction on forming and finishing pieces for electric firing, schedules for firing both manual and computerized kilns, and has lavishly illustrated the book with completely new images that highlight many of the most exciting results that are possible with electric firing. Electric Kiln Ceramics has become the path countless professionals and enthusiasts have followed to gain understanding and proficiency working with electric kilns in the ceramics studio. From Zakin embracing and promoting the electric kiln as a tool that yields exciting results to Bartolovic presenting it within the frame of contemporary practice, technology, and aesthetics, Electric Kiln Ceramics promises to continue inspiring and educating ceramic artists for generations to come. Three books in one! Electric Kiln Ceramics is separated into three chapters on Clay, Glaze, and The Electric Kiln, but the book covers each of these in such depth that each chapter could be a book on its own. Each chapter is logically organized, making searching for specific information easy.
